The Science Behind Muscle Recovery Cryotherapy
Muscle recovery cryotherapy is grounded in physiological responses that trigger natural healing. When the body is exposed to extreme cold, blood vessels constrict and then dilate once the session ends. This process flushes out toxins, increases oxygen-rich blood flow, and promotes nutrient delivery to affected muscles. Additionally, the cold exposure stimulates the release of endorphins and other natural chemicals that reduce pain and improve mood.
